## Onboarding note — TimeGrid deploys

For this week's sync: TimeGrid is our school timetable solver, deployed to the Ashbourne district cluster every Thursday. New folks should know that deploys go through the Lintwell pipeline, which verifies artifact signatures before rollout. Solver config changes ride the same train. To get your first deploy through, sign your build artifact with the team key below.

signing key of bagap-yawep = bky13_TbfT6ZMUoGJo2

Subject: Undo/redo cut-over complete

Hi Soren — the Marwick diagram editor now uses the new command-stack service for undo and redo; the legacy snapshot store is read-only as of last night. History depth and coalescing rules moved server-side. You'll need the current production settings, which are as follows.

config for kafof-bawef:
holath:
  log_level: debug
  metrics_host: metrics.holath.qorvelsys.internal
  pin: 2191
  pool_size: 32

## Contrast Audit Thresholds

The Glimmerveil audit pass walks every rendered component in the Tintworks design system and computes foreground/background contrast ratios. Ratios below the failure cutoff block the build; ratios in the warning band are logged for the accessibility review queue. We deliberately set the warning band wider than the spec minimum so drift gets caught before it ships. Reviewers should confirm that any threshold change is mirrored in the CI gate config. The tuning constants used by the audit are defined here.

tuning constants:
RATE_LIMITS = {
    "wenwyn": 1,
    "zorix": 10,
    "oliix": 2,
    "holael": 10,
}

### Runbook: Master Key Set — Brindlemoor Depot

Quick one for the records team: the Brindlemoor master key set goes out once a quarter for re-pinning at the Calloway workshop. Keys travel in the red lockbox, never loose, and the box gets logged out and back in the register — no exceptions, even if Tomas says it's fine. Return run is same-day. When the courier arrives to collect the lockbox, the hand-over goes exactly like this.

handover note for yagef-bagep: the drudor pelius courier leaves the kasdor zorvan norir ledger at gate 8016 under passcode 755406